разработка концептуальной и логической модели ИСУ ОСАГО
Заказать уникальную курсовую работу- 32 32 страницы
- 12 + 12 источников
- Добавлена 27.01.2021
- Содержание
- Часть работы
- Список литературы
Введение 3
1. Аналитическая часть 5
1.1. Характеристика предприятия и его деятельности 5
1.2 Программная и техническая архитектура ИС предприятия 9
1.3 Анализ бизнес-процессов страховой деятельности 13
2. Информационная модель страховой деятельности 18
2.1. Характеристика нормативно-справочной, входной и оперативной информации 18
2.2 Программное обеспечение задачи 23
2.2 Характеристика базы данных 24
2.3. Описание программных модулей 26
Заключение 30
Список использованной литературы 31
Структура выходного документа «Анализ структуры страховых услуг»:Анализ структуры страховых услугПериод:№Вид услугиКоличествоСуммы взносов, руб.Структура выходного документа «Анализ динамики объёма страховых взносов»:Анализ динамики объема страховых взносовВид услуги:по всем видам страховых услугМесяцГодСумма кредитов, руб.Отклонение фактического объема страховых взносов от плановогоВид кредитапо всем видам услуг страхованияМесяцГодПлан, руб.Факт, руб.Отклонение, руб.Суммы страховых взносов по сотрудникамПериод:№ФИОДолжностьСумма страховых взносов2.2 Программное обеспечение задачиСхема «Дерево функций» позволяет наглядно показать иерархию функций управления и обработки данных, которые автоматизированы в разработанном программном продукте.Выделяется два подмножества функций программы (рис.2.4): служебные функции (проверка пароля, управление окнами и др.);основные функции обработки данных (ввода первичной информации, обработки, ведения справочников, подготовки и распечатки документов и др.).Рисунок 2.4 - Дерево функцийНа рисунке 2.5 приведен сценарий диалога системы.Рисунок 2.5 - Сценарий диалога системы2.2 Характеристика базы данныхОписание структуры таблиц базы данных приведено ниже.Таблица 3.3–Структура таблицы «clients»Наименование поляТип данныхРазмер поля123codeintnamchar20adrchar15typchar50Таблица 3.4 - Структура таблицы «model»Наименование поляТип данныхРазмер поля123codeintnamchar200MoshintTypcharТаблица 3.5 – Структура таблицы «ts»Наименование поляТип данныхРазмер поля123codeintModelintYearintStmcurrencyCode_cliIntТаблица 3.6 - Структура таблицы «dogov»Наименование поляТип данныхРазмер поля123codeintcode_crintcode_clintsum_crmoneysrokintdaydateФизическая модель данных приведена на рис.2.6.Рисунок 2.6 - Физическая модель данныхПарольная защита и система разграничения доступа основана на:- авторизации на уровне СУБД;- авторизации на уровне приложения.Исходя из требований к уровню безопасности при выполнении технологических операций, авторизация производится через пароль к приложению, либо к базе данных напрямую.Уровни доступа на уровне СУБД определяются как стандартные по отношению к работе с данными (public, dbowner, dbadmin и т.д.).Авторизация на уровне приложения делает возможным или невозможным выполнение конкретных пользовательских функций.2.3. Описание программных модулейВ качестве примера рассмотрим модуль формирования свода по специалистам (М9). При вызове модуля на экран выводится запрос интервала дат. Далее, после отработки SQL-запроса производится загрузка данных его результатов в шаблон отчёта. В таблице 23 приведена структура предоставления, содержащего данные указанного отчета. Таблица Структура записи представления zp3(«Свод по специалистам»).№ п/пНаименование показателяИдентификаторТип1Код строкиidInt2Код сотрудникаCode_sotrInt3ФИО сотрудника. FioVarchar(100)4Дата заказаDay_zakDatetime5Количество принятых заказовCount (code_zak)intНа рисунке 2.9 приведена развёрнутая блок-схема модуля формирования свода по специалистам.Виды доступа к созданной базе данных:- администратор (с правами работы со справочниками и настройки прав доступа остальных пользователей);- старший специалист (с правами работы со справочниками, связанными с технологией работы, а также на выполнение технологических операций и формирования отчетов);- специалист по кредитованию (только с доступом к режиму работы соответствующего модуля).Рисунок 2.9 - Расширенная блок-схема модуля формирования свода по специалистамРазграничение уровней доступа по ролям пользователей приведено в таблице 3.1.Таблица 3.1 - Разграничение уровней доступа по ролям пользователейРежимы работыРоли пользователейАдминистраторСтарший СпециалистСпециалист по планированиюСправочник клиентовXXСправочник видов транспортаXСправочник – сотрудникиXXВвод планов оказания услуг страхованияXВвод договоров страхованияXОтчет- Анализ структуры договоров страхованияXОтчет – Анализ динамики страховых суммXОтчет – Отклонение фактических объемов оказанных услуг от плановыхXЗаключениеВ рамках данной работы проведено создание автоматизированной информационной системы учета договоров ОСАГО и КАСКО для страховой компании ООО "Страхователь ОСАГО". В аналитической части работы проведен анализ предметной области, определены задачи автоматизации, включающие: ведение картотеки страховых тарифов ОСАГО, клиентов, учет страховых случаев.Показано, что внедрение информационной системы создаст возможности оперативного получения информации о реализованных страховых полисах, страховых случаях, необходимости резервирования бланков строгой отчетности. В практической части работы проведено создание информационной модели (определен набор атрибутов информационной системы, проведена установка межтабличных связей, построены логическая и физическая модели данных). Показано, что информационная система страховой компании в части работы с ОСАГО должна включать картотеку транспортных средств, клиентов, вести учет дисконта за безаварийное вождение.Список использованной литературыБекаревич Ю. Б., Пушкина Н. В. Самоучитель MS SQLServer / Юрий Бекаревич, Нина Пушкина. - Санкт-Петербург : БХВ-Петербург, 2017. - 480 с.Козелецкая Т.А. Информационные системы и технологии. Система управления базами данных MS SQLServer : учебное пособие / Т. А. Козелецкая. - Санкт-Петербург: Изд-во Политехнического университета, 2017. - 146 с. Дмитриева Т. А. Базы данных : система управления базами данных MS SQLServer : учебное пособие / Т.А. Дмитриева. - Санкт-Петербург : Политех-Пресс, 2019. - 167 с. Овчаренко О. И. Проектирование и работа с реляционными базами данных в MS SQLServer: учебное пособие / О. И. Овчаренко. - Таганрог: Изд-во НОУ ВПО "Таганрогский институт управления и экономики", 2015. - 73 с.Букунов С. В., Букунова О. В. Применение СУБД MS SQLServer для создания бизнес-приложений : учебное пособие / С. В. Букунов, О. В. Букунова. - Санкт-Петербург : Санкт-Петербургский государственный архитектурно-строительный университет, 2017. – 103c.Помазанов В. В., Лунина Е. С. Информационные технологии в юридической деятельности : учебное пособие / В. В. Помазанов, Е. С. Лунина. - Краснодар: КубГАУ, 2017. - 178 с.Литвинов В. А. Проектирование информационных систем: учебное пособие / В.А. Литвинов. - Санкт-Петербург: Питер, 2016. - 320 с.Шмелева С. В. Проектирование информационных систем: конспект лекций / С. В. Шмелева. - Москва: Российский университет дружбы народов, 2018. - 72 с.Федоров В. В. Проектирование информационных систем: учебник / В. В. Федоров. - Санкт-Петербург: Интермедия, 2015. - 479 с.Соболева И. А., Криветченко О. В., Мельчукова Л. В. Информационные технологии: учебное пособие / И. А. Соболева, О. В. Криветченко, Л. В. Мельчукова. - Новосибирск: Новосибирский государственный университет экономики и управления "НИНХ", 2015. – 199с.Данелян Т. Я. Информационные технологии: учебно-методический комплекс / Т. Я. Данелян. - Москва: МЭСИ, 2016. - 283 с.Никитин А. В. Информационные технологии: учебное пособие / А. В. Никитин. - Санкт-Петербург: Изд-во Санкт-Петербургского государственного экономического университета, 2017. - 156 с.
1. Бекаревич Ю. Б., Пушкина Н. В. Самоучитель MS SQL Server / Юрий Бекаревич, Нина Пушкина. - Санкт-Петербург : БХВ-Петербург, 2017. - 480 с.
2. Козелецкая Т.А. Информационные системы и технологии. Система управления базами данных MS SQL Server : учебное пособие / Т. А. Козелецкая. - Санкт-Петербург: Изд-во Политехнического университета, 2017. - 146 с.
3. Дмитриева Т. А. Базы данных : система управления базами данных MS SQL Server : учебное пособие / Т.А. Дмитриева. - Санкт-Петербург : Политех-Пресс, 2019. - 167 с.
4. Овчаренко О. И. Проектирование и работа с реляционными базами данных в MS SQL Server : учебное пособие / О. И. Овчаренко. - Таганрог: Изд-во НОУ ВПО "Таганрогский институт управления и экономики", 2015. - 73 с.
5. Букунов С. В., Букунова О. В. Применение СУБД MS SQL Server для создания бизнес-приложений : учебное пособие / С. В. Букунов, О. В. Букунова. - Санкт-Петербург : Санкт-Петербургский государственный архитектурно-строительный университет, 2017. – 103c.
6. Помазанов В. В., Лунина Е. С. Информационные технологии в юридической деятельности : учебное пособие / В. В. Помазанов, Е. С. Лунина. - Краснодар: КубГАУ, 2017. - 178 с.
7. Литвинов В. А. Проектирование информационных систем: учебное пособие / В.А. Литвинов. - Санкт-Петербург: Питер, 2016. - 320 с.
8. Шмелева С. В. Проектирование информационных систем: конспект лекций / С. В. Шмелева. - Москва: Российский университет дружбы народов, 2018. - 72 с.
9. Федоров В. В. Проектирование информационных систем: учебник / В. В. Федоров. - Санкт-Петербург: Интермедия, 2015. - 479 с.
10. Соболева И. А., Криветченко О. В., Мельчукова Л. В. Информационные технологии: учебное пособие / И. А. Соболева, О. В. Криветченко, Л. В. Мельчукова. - Новосибирск: Новосибирский государственный университет экономики и управления "НИНХ", 2015. – 199с.
11. Данелян Т. Я. Информационные технологии: учебно-методический комплекс / Т. Я. Данелян. - Москва: МЭСИ, 2016. - 283 с.
12. Никитин А. В. Информационные технологии: учебное пособие / А. В. Никитин. - Санкт-Петербург: Изд-во Санкт-Петербургского государственного экономического университета, 2017. - 156 с.